As the capital of Liechtenstein, Vaduz is the country's financial and economic hub. As you walk through the city, Vaduz may seem out of place in comparison to most European capitals. The country's recent prosperity means that its architecture is extremely modern, save for its most popular attraction, the Vaduz Castle. Nestled high above the city, the medieval fortress watches over the prosperous metropolis below. This is still home to the Prince of Liechtenstein and is a reminder that the small country even has its own monarchy.

The Result
Countries receiving most 12 points / Iraq, 6
Countries giving 12 points to the winner / Israel, Poland, Cyprus, Greece, Mexico and Serbia
Countries receiving points from most juries / Iraq, 25
Highest placing country not scoring a top mark / South Africa in 8th with 10 points from Japan as highest mark
Lowest placing country scoring a top mark / Guinea in 23rd, getting 12 points from Algeria
For the first third of the voting everything was open and exciting, but after the 12th jury Iraq took the lead and never looked back, reaching an all time highscore of 195 points. This record was previously held by Cyprus, who scored 194 points in GM59. United States took home the silver, and the bronze went to Finland. Slovenia and Israel rounded out the top 5.
This is Iraq's first entry in Global Music and it thus becomes the 5th country to win the contest on its debut. They join Sweden, Cyprus, Tunisia and Guatemala in this exclusive club. Seth has only been with us for a short time as well. He started of as HoD for Kenya, but after two failed attempts of reaching the final, he changed to Iran for one attempt, before he chose Iraq, making this his first appearance in a final, his first top 10 result, and his first gold medal all in one! Well done Iraq, Soma and Seth!
